Output 530606d8fbba944d822cee4078c0cb94ef20e6ab33d6897b6a24786a891b59d9:38

value
56448
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a885bf53e463cd0a4200693874fe62f029f0f66b OP_EQUAL
address
3H45fhepf1xU5pZB5aF9edc4mRDoYQ6r2t
transaction
530606d8fbba944d822cee4078c0cb94ef20e6ab33d6897b6a24786a891b59d9
spent
true